Currituck County lost against Perquimans on September 4th,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Monday. The Knights came up short against the Pirates, falling 3-0. For those keeping track at home, that's the biggest defeat the Knights have suffered since September 8th.
The match finished with set scores of 25-17, 25-17, 25-13.
Morgan Cheesbrough paced Currituck County's offense, picking up eight kills. Cheesbrough got some help from Melody Hill and her 16 assists.

The loss snapped Currituck County's winning streak at five games and leaves them with a 6-11 record. As for Perquimans, they pushed their record up to 16-3 with the win, which was their seventh straight at home.
Currituck County wasted no time getting back out on the court and has already played their next match, a 3-0 victory against Pasquotank County on the 23rd. As for Perquimans, they have also already played their next game, a 3-0 win against Bertie on the 23rd.
